Noddy Themed Cupcakes

Ingredients (makes 12 cupcakesor 9 cupcakes + 9 mini cupcakes):

  • 175g softened butter (or dairy free spread)
  • 175g golden caster sugar
  • 3 large eggs
  • 175g self raising flour
  • 2 Tbsp milk (or dairy free alternative)
  • 2 tsp vanilla extract

For the butter icing:

  • 100g softened butter or dairy free spread
  • 225g icing sugar
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1 Tbsp milk or dairy free equivalent
  • green gel food colouring

To decorate:

  • red, yellow, green and blue fondant icing
  • white sugar pearl sprinkles
  • Mini Matchmakers chocolates

Method:

Preheat the oven to 180°C (Gas mark 4/350°F). Line a 12 hole muffin tin with 12 cupcakecases. If preferred, you could also use 9 cupcakecases plus 9 mini cupcake cases in a mini muffintin.

Pop the butter or dairy free spreadinto a mixing bowl and whisk together withthe caster sugar until light and fluffy. Break the eggs into a bowl and lightly whisk with a fork. Add the eggs a little at a time to the butter and sugar mix, whisking in between. Sift the flour on top, and using an electric whisk on a low speed, gently blend the ingredients together. Add the milk and vanilla extract and blend again. Increase the mixer speed and whisk for a few more seconds until well mixed.

Divide the cake mixture between the cupcakecases and smooth over the tops. Bake the mini cupcakes for 16-18 minutes and the normal cupcakes for 20-25 minutes until risen and springyto the touch.

Meanwhile, make the buttercream icing. Whisk the butter with an electric whisk until light and fluffy. Sift in the icing sugar, a little at a time, until completely combined. Add the vanilla extract and whisk again. Add the milk in small splashes until the icing is at the correct consistency for piping.

Place one third of the buttercream icingin a separate bowl and colour the remainder green with gel food colouring. Cover both bowls and store in the fridge until ready to use.

Once the cakes are cooked, transfer to a wire rack to cool. Whilst the cakes are cooling, create your Noddy themedtoppers from the fondant icing ready to decorate the cakes. Once cool, decorate each cupcake with a swirl of buttercream icing and a Noddy themed fondant topper. Store in an airtight container until ready to serve.
